Getting to Know Fort Myers, FL

Wake up to beautiful weather, swaying palm trees and wondrous wildlife in scenic Fort Myers, FL. Fort Myers is a medium-sized city that has grown in population by 40% since 2000. Known for its year-round mild climate and warm Gulf Coast beaches, Fort Myers is a popular destination for young families, retirees and visitors alike.

 

Fort Myers Attractions
In addition to the relaxing shores of the Gulf Coast, many attractions in Fort Myers are centered around the area's maritime and natural history. Be sure to check out the Calusa Nature Center & Planetarium, complete with a planetarium, history museum, butterfly sanctuary, nature trails and picnic area. Nearby Sanibel and Captiva Islands are world-renowned for seashells, and have their own nature preserves and guided tours, perfect for viewing alligators and dolphins in their natural habitat. Art lovers and sports fans should pay a visit to the Art of the Olympians Museum, which features the artistic works of past Olympic competitors on display.

 

 

Fort Myers Neighborhoods and Apartments
If you're looking to be near the water, the coastal neighborhood of Town Center, located on Fort Myers Beach, is the choice for you. From the bustle of downtown Fort Myers to quiet communities like Gateway, you're sure to find an affordable housing option near local attractions and schools. Here are our top picks of Fort Myers neighborhoods:

River District: Centrally located in downtown Fort Myers, the River District is home to fine dining, shopping and events.

  • Gateway: Gateway is a family-oriented community with dog parks, running trails and swimming pools.
  • San Carlos Park: With access to three separate schooling zones, San Carlos Park is a top choice for families with young children, and it's also popular among college students.
  • Danforth Lakes: Danforth Lakes is a popular choice among young families for its proximity to many high-ranking schools, as well as I-75.

Fun Things to Do in Fort Myers
If you're looking for free things to do in Fort Myers, head to Manatee Park from November to March to watch manatees emerge from the shallow water and afterward visit the on-site butterfly garden or playground. Sports fans won't want to miss an afternoon of homeruns and fly balls at the Boston Red Sox and Minnesota Twins spring training games hosted at JetBlue Park. Windsurfing is popular on the Sanibel Causeway. The annual Edison Festival of Light parade - held at night - is exciting.

Fort Myers Families with Children
Complete with hiking and biking trails, a rock climbing wall, a splash park and a scenic railroad, Lakes Park is an ideal location for family outings. The Lee school district services 125 schools in the region, with Florida Southwestern Collegiate High School and Three Oaks Elementary School noted for their high rankings.

 

Coastal Beauty in Fort Myers
The area's natural beauty is highlighted by the fantastic views afforded in many Fort Myers condo rentals, making patio and balcony additions a must. There's nothing quite like viewing the sunset over the Gulf or watching seafaring birds catching fish or preening among the shells and rocks at the shoreline. You can also get up close to marine life and native birds on a scenic kayak or canoe trip along the Great Calusa Blueway. Shelling is a favorite pastime on Sanibel and adjacent Captiva Island.

Island Getaways near Fort Myers
Sanibel Island, only minutes away, is one of the best beaches in the area, known for its stunning seashell-lined shore. Head to the nearby Captiva Island, an hour from Fort Myers, for pristine white, sandy beaches and unforgettable sunset views.



Frequently Asked Questions About Fort Myers

What is the average rent in Fort Myers?

The average rent of a studio apartment in Fort Myers is $1,357 per month. For a one-bedroom apartment it's $1,717 per month. For a two-bedroom apartment the average rent is $2,055 per month.

What is the average cost of rent for a one-bedroom in Fort Myers?

The average rent of a one-bedroom apartment in Fort Myers is $1,717
